(ESI) reported Q1 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of $0.41, beating the consensus estimate of $0.3853 by 6.41%. Revenue figures were not disclosed in the report. Following the announcement, the stock rose 1.22%, indicating a positive market reaction to the stronger-than-expected bottom-line performance.
